Cost

A formal diagnosis of ADHD can assist you in receiving the support you require. You can receive treatment privately or through NHS referral. Many patients choose to pay for a private assessment due to the fact that the NHS can be slow. You can save money and time by taking advantage of a private assessment. However it is essential that the person who conducts the evaluation has the correct qualifications. GPs are not qualified to diagnose ADHD, so it is crucial to go to an expert psychologist or psychiatrist.

A private ADHD evaluation costs between PS500-PS800. This includes time for consultation, a written report, and a drug trial. In the course of your assessment, you'll meet with a neurobehavioural psychiatric specialist who specializes in ADHD. They will discuss your symptoms, your mental health history, and family history. They will also offer suggestions for non-medicative treatments. The assessment can last up to an hour and you will be able to choose the best treatment for your needs.

Depending on your provider and the type of service you choose, a private ADHD assessment could include an in-person consultation or a video or telephonic follow-up. Contact the provider to inquire about their policy. Some require an GP referral letter, whereas others don't. If your GP refuses to refer you, it might be worth finding another one, especially in the event that you're interested in a shared care agreement for a future medication.

Many people are willing pay for an individual ADHD diagnosis because the NHS can take up to five years to conduct an assessment. This is due to the fact that there are a lot of patients on the waiting lists for assessments, and it's difficult to cope while they wait. Having an official diagnosis can help them to access assistance and treatment that can improve their quality of life.

The BBC's Panorama investigation has uncovered malpractice at several private ADHD clinics, however it is crucial to remember that the majority of private clinics provide high standards. It is also important to note that ADHD is a serious disorder that if left untreated can lead to problems in the workplace, education, and relationships. Additionally it is linked to an 12.7 year decrease in life expectancy, which is comparable to the case of Type 2 diabetes.

Unfortunately the NHS isn't equipped with enough resources to satisfy the demand for ADHD assessments. Patients have to wait for long periods of time before seeking private clinics. However, Panorama's research revealed that some private clinics provide unreliable diagnoses. This could put vulnerable patients at risk and lead to unnecessary treatments.

In England, GPs are legally entitled to refer adults to any service for an ADHD assessment, as long that the provider is registered with NHS assessments in their area. This is known as Right to Choose, and it can cut down on waiting times for assessments. However, the GP must still be able to accept the referral.

The NHS is currently in a state of crisis, and investment in adult ADHD services has been reduced by more than PS70 million since 2009. The psychiatrists' rotas that assess adults are stuffed, and there is an enormous mismatch between the demand and the capacity. This has led to the proliferation of shortcuts ranging from online assessments to fake methods like those on Panorama.
